に常開型の電磁弁13を配置してなる波動弁。In a wave motion valve that opens and closes the on-off valve 4 that opens and closes the fluid passage 1 by accumulating and releasing the liquid pressure supplied from the electromagnetic pump 10, a pressure receiving chamber 8 that opens and closes the on-off valve 4.
and an atmospheric chamber 9 are provided, and the inside of the pressure receiving chamber 8 is connected to a liquid source 11 via an electromagnetic pump 10, and the upper and downstream sides of the electromagnetic pump 10 are connected via a bypass passage 14 in which an electromagnetic valve 13 is arranged. On the other hand, an elastic member 12 such as a spring is compressed and arranged in the atmospheric chamber 9, and the electrical circuit of the electromagnetic pump 10 is normally closed to open the electrical circuit when the on-off valve 4 opens beyond a certain degree. This is a wave motion valve in which a type position detection switch 15 is arranged in series, and a normally open type electromagnetic valve 13 is arranged in parallel with an electromagnetic pump 10 and a position detection long switch 15.
